An electric car’s range will depend on the make and condition of the vehicle, as well as its driving habits and conditions. Although electric cars have a shorter range than traditional gasoline cars, technological advancements have made them more common in recent years.
Nowadays, most electric cars offer a range of between 100-300 miles on a single charge. Some models, however, can go further; the Tesla Model S for example can travel up to 405 miles while Lucid Air goes as far as 520 miles. Although these longer-range electric vehicles tend to be more expensive, drivers who frequently need to cover longer distances may find these investments worthwhile.
Many factors can reduce an electric car’s range. Temperature is one of the primary determining factors; extreme heat or cold may weaken its battery, leading to shorter journeys. Driving style also plays a role; aggressive habits like hard braking and sudden acceleration increase power consumption and reduce the range significantly. Furthermore, certain accessories like heating or air conditioning may reduce range as well.
Drivers can take several steps to maximize the range and efficiency of an electric vehicle. One way to maximize your car’s range is to avoid driving aggressively; instead, focus on maintaining a steady speed with fewer stops/starts. Preconditioning the cabin temperature while still plugged in can reduce energy use for heating or cooling it; finally, drivers have the option to utilize apps or websites for planning routes and finding charging stations.
